Guarding Against Prompt Injection
With the rise of tools like 'ai-prompt-guard', companies must prioritize security in AI interactions. Protecting your applications from prompt injection attacks is crucial for maintaining data integrity and user trust.
- Review your current AI applications for vulnerabilities to prompt injection.
- Implement prompt injection protection mechanisms where necessary.
- Conduct security training for your team to raise awareness.
